AI Summary

  • Requests the University of Hawaii expand the Osher Lifelong Learning Institute to all campuses within the University of Hawaii System
  • Notes the senior population aged 65-69 will increase 37 percent and those 70+ will increase 38 percent nationally from 2010 to 2020
  • Highlights that Hawaii's population aged 75+ increased 116 percent from 1990 to 2012, significantly higher than the national trend
  • Currently, the Osher Lifelong Learning Institute operates only at the University of Hawaii Manoa campus on the south side of Oahu
  • Recognizes continuing education as a way to maintain mental health and prevent age-related cognitive decline among seniors (kupuna)
